Contents: This book is an in-depth study of all Allied escort ship classes built between 1939 and 1945 and used so extensively in anti-submarine, anti-aircraft, surface, and assault operations. Each navy has its own section, with a chapter for each class, covering design evolution, major conversions, and war service. A special feature describes the guns, anti-submarine weapons, and radar sets that were fitted to the escorts. There is also a glossary of terms and a complete index to the ships by name. Illustrated with over 330 photographs and specially prepared drawings.
